Features of gel polish

On sale today are the usual to use tools for nail care and to create a manicure. The colors of the varnish can be even the most unusual and it is not difficult to apply it, as well as remove it, at home.

Another thing is the novelty of this industry - gel polish, the coating of which is characterized by increased resistance to water and other adverse factors, as well as mechanical strength. That is why it is recommended to remove such an analogue of artificial nails using special technology only in professional salons.

Important! As practice shows, remove gel polish at home it is still possible, and by the same means as ordinary varnish. But at the same time, it is necessary to take into account the fact that due to the strength of the coating it requires a longer, longer exposure to the solvent.

Fatal error while removing gel polish from nails

Cases when you cannot get an appointment with your master for correction on time, unfortunately, happen quite often. And here most of us begin to resort to barbaric methods, ruthless, and also cruel to our nails directly: to remove the varnish from the surface of the nails, simply peeling it off.

Important! This method is often used at home unknowingly, which by itself leads to the fact that the nails become dry, brittle, thin.

Surely, most have heard that the varnish spoils the nails. As a rule, similar reviews are left by girls who remove it in a similar way. Because tearing off the varnish, along with it, these girls removed the entire top layer of the plate. It is from here that all the problems that we mentioned above appear.

However, this is not a reason to refuse a beautiful and durable manicure. With a fairly competent approach, you can remove gel polish at home without any problems, while maintaining the health and strength of your own nails.

How to remove gel polish from the surface of the nails?

The easiest way to remove the gel polish will be in the case when you ask in advance what means the master uses during work. As a rule, the official websites of such companies contain detailed information on how to eliminate coverage, and also provide a list of the safest and most effective means.

If you do not know which way to choose, we suggest that you get acquainted with the universal option that is used at home by a large number of women.

To complete the procedure, you must prepare the following tools and instruments:

  • The most ordinary liquid in order to remove the varnish, which contains acetone. A product that does not contain acetone.will not be able to cope with the task, and you simply spend your precious time.
  • Foil. You can use both food foil, which is used for baking a variety of dishes, and foil, in which our beloved chocolates are wrapped.
  • Orange stick - with it you remove the softened coating.
  • Glass and sanding file - it will come in handy for sanding nails.
  • Cotton wool or discs.

Nail polish remover

As mentioned above, this tool is suitable in order to remove gel polish at home, but the exposure time should be longer. For this:

  1. Prepare small pieces of cotton wool.
  2. Moisten them with liquid.
  3. Put on your nails.
  4. Wrap them in foil - this is necessary in order to prevent drying of the solvent.
  5. Soak for up to 20 minutes.
  6. Remove everything and try to remove the gel polish.

What to do if varnish gets on your clothes?

If the issue of eliminating varnish from the surface of the nails is not particularly difficult, then in order to eliminate it from clothing, you will have to suffer a little.

Take gel polish remover that contains acetone and start “conjuring”:

  1. Blot the dirt with a paper towel, removing all residues to the maximum.
  2. Sprinkle the area of ​​contamination with talcum powder or starch, and place a paper cloth under it.
  3. Proceed with the treatment with acetone, soaking cotton wool in the liquid - to begin with from the wrong side.
  4. To complete, wipe the area of ​​contamination with a small amount of glycerin, and then wash.
